Twenty-six clones of birdsfoot trefoil (Lotus corniculatus L.) were evaluated to determine relationships between seed yield and its components. This relationship was examined by means of simple correlation coefficients. Some seed yield components were found significatively associated with seed yield. Variations in seed yield accounted for by variation in the characteristics measured were calculated by stepwise regression analysis.
The analysis showed that number of cluster per plant (X1) and number of pods per cluster (X3) had the greatest influence on seed yield. When these two variables were acting together, they accounted for 60.49 percent of the variation in seed yield. Total variation due to components was only 65.46 percent. Predicted yields based on regression coefficients did not show significant differences with harvested seed yield. This indicates that seed yield could be estimated by using only these two variables.
